A petition must be filed in the Regional Trial Court by the person in custody or having charge of an insane
person. If he refuses to do so and where it is required for the welfare of the insane person or of the public, the
petition shall be filed by the Director of Health or the present authorized officer.
Once the insane person is judicially committed to the hospital or asylum, the Director of Health cannot order his
